# cshape-client-offline
|
||||
|
||||
这是一个基于FunASR-Websocket服务器的CShape客户端,用于转录本地音频文件。
|
||||
|
||||
将配置文件放在与程序相同目录下的config文件夹中,并在config.ini中配置服务器ip地址和端口号。
|
||||
|
||||
配置好服务端ip和端口号,在vs中打开需添加Websocket.Client的Nuget程序包后,可直接进行测试,按照控制台提示操作即可。
|
||||
|
||||
更新:支持热词和时间戳,热词需将config文件夹下的hotword.txt放置在执行路径下。
|
||||
|
||||
注:运行后台须注意热词和时间戳为不同模型,本客户端在win11下完成测试,编译环境VS2022。

# cshape-client-online
|
||||
|
||||
这是一个基于FunASR-Websocket服务器的CShape客户端,用于实时语音识别和转录本地音频文件。
|
||||
|
||||
将配置文件放在与程序相同目录下的config文件夹中,并在config.ini中配置服务器ip地址和端口号。
|
||||
|
||||
配置好服务端ip和端口号,在vs中打开需添加NAudio和Websocket.Client的Nuget程序包后,可直接进行测试,按照控制台提示操作即可。
|
||||
|
||||
注:实时语音识别使用online或2pass,转录文件默认使用offline,在win11下完成测试,编译环境VS2022。
